#ifndef __SSP_SENSORS_H__
#define __SSP_SENSORS_H__
#define SENSOR_NAME_MAX_LEN 35
/* SENSOR_TYPE */
enum {
ACCELEROMETER_SENSOR = 0,
GYROSCOPE_SENSOR,
GEOMAGNETIC_UNCALIB_SENSOR,
GEOMAGNETIC_RAW,
GEOMAGNETIC_SENSOR,
PRESSURE_SENSOR,
GESTURE_SENSOR,
PROXIMITY_SENSOR,
TEMPERATURE_HUMIDITY_SENSOR,
LIGHT_SENSOR,
PROXIMITY_RAW,
#ifdef CONFIG_SENSORS_SSP_SX9306
GRIP_SENSOR,
ORIENTATION_SENSOR,
#else
ORIENTATION_SENSOR = 12,
#endif
STEP_DETECTOR = 13,
SIG_MOTION_SENSOR,
GYRO_UNCALIB_SENSOR,
GAME_ROTATION_VECTOR = 16,
ROTATION_VECTOR,
STEP_COUNTER,
BIO_HRM_RAW,
BIO_HRM_RAW_FAC,
BIO_HRM_LIB,
SHAKE_CAM = 23,
#ifdef CONFIG_SENSORS_SSP_IRDATA_FOR_CAMERA
LIGHT_IR_SENSOR = 24,
#endif
#ifdef CONFIG_SENSORS_SSP_INTERRUPT_GYRO_SENSOR
INTERRUPT_GYRO_SENSOR = 25,
#endif
TILT_DETECTOR,
PICKUP_GESTURE,
BULK_SENSOR,
GPS_SENSOR,
PROXIMITY_ALERT_SENSOR,
LIGHT_FLICKER_SENSOR,
LIGHT_CCT_SENSOR,
ACCEL_UNCALIB_SENSOR = 33,
THERMISTOR_SENSOR,
PROXIMITY_POCKET,
WAKE_UP_MOTION,
MOVE_DETECTOR = 37,
CALL_GESTURE = 38,
UNCAL_LIGHT_SENSOR = 40,
LED_COVER_EVENT_SENSOR = 42,
POCKET_MODE_LITE = 43,
AUTO_ROTATION_SENSOR = 48,
SAR_BACKOFF_MOTION = 50,
SENSOR_MAX,
#ifdef CONFIG_SENSORS_SSP_HIFI_BATCHING
META_SENSOR = 200,
#endif
};
/* Sensors's reporting mode */
#define REPORT_MODE_CONTINUOUS 0
#define REPORT_MODE_ON_CHANGE 1
#define REPORT_MODE_SPECIAL 2
#define REPORT_MODE_UNKNOWN 3
#define SCONTEXT_DATA_SIZE 72
struct sensor_info {
char *name;
int type;
bool enable;
int report_mode;
int get_data_len;
int report_data_len;
};
#define SENSOR_INFO_UNKNOWN {"", -1, false, REPORT_MODE_UNKNOWN, 0, 0}
#define SENSOR_INFO_ACCELEROMETER {"accelerometer_sensor", ACCELEROMETER_SENSOR, true, REPORT_MODE_CONTINUOUS, 6, 6}
#define SENSOR_INFO_GEOMAGNETIC {"geomagnetic_sensor", GEOMAGNETIC_SENSOR, true, REPORT_MODE_CONTINUOUS, 8, 8}
#define SENSOR_INFO_GEOMAGNETIC_POWER {"geomagnetic_power", GEOMAGNETIC_RAW, false, REPORT_MODE_CONTINUOUS, 6, 0}
#define SENSOR_INFO_GEOMAGNETIC_UNCAL {"uncal_geomagnetic_sensor", GEOMAGNETIC_UNCALIB_SENSOR, true, REPORT_MODE_CONTINUOUS, 13, 13}
#define SENSOR_INFO_GYRO {"gyro_sensor", GYROSCOPE_SENSOR, true, REPORT_MODE_CONTINUOUS, 12, 12}
#define SENSOR_INFO_GYRO_UNCALIBRATED {"uncal_gyro_sensor", GYRO_UNCALIB_SENSOR, true, REPORT_MODE_CONTINUOUS, 24, 24}
#define SENSOR_INFO_INTERRUPT_GYRO {"interrupt_gyro_sensor", INTERRUPT_GYRO_SENSOR, true, REPORT_MODE_ON_CHANGE, 12, 12}
#define SENSOR_INFO_PRESSURE {"pressure_sensor", PRESSURE_SENSOR, true, REPORT_MODE_CONTINUOUS, 6, 12}
#ifdef CONFIG_SENSORS_SSP_LIGHT_MAX_GAIN_2BYTE
#define SENSOR_INFO_LIGHT {"light_sensor", LIGHT_SENSOR, true, REPORT_MODE_ON_CHANGE, 19, 19}
#define SENSOR_INFO_UNCAL_LIGHT {"uncal_light_sensor", UNCAL_LIGHT_SENSOR, true, REPORT_MODE_CONTINUOUS, 19, 19}
#define SENSOR_INFO_LIGHT_IR {"light_ir_sensor", LIGHT_IR_SENSOR, true, REPORT_MODE_ON_CHANGE, 13, 13}
#define SENSOR_INFO_LIGHT_CCT {"light_cct_sensor", LIGHT_CCT_SENSOR, true, REPORT_MODE_ON_CHANGE, 19, 19}
#else
#define SENSOR_INFO_LIGHT {"light_sensor", LIGHT_SENSOR, true, REPORT_MODE_ON_CHANGE, 18, 18}
#define SENSOR_INFO_UNCAL_LIGHT {"uncal_light_sensor", UNCAL_LIGHT_SENSOR, true, REPORT_MODE_CONTINUOUS, 18, 18}
#define SENSOR_INFO_LIGHT_IR {"light_ir_sensor", LIGHT_IR_SENSOR, true, REPORT_MODE_ON_CHANGE, 12, 12}
#define SENSOR_INFO_LIGHT_CCT {"light_cct_sensor", LIGHT_CCT_SENSOR, true, REPORT_MODE_ON_CHANGE, 18, 18}
#endif
#define SENSOR_INFO_LIGHT_FLICKER {"light_flicker_sensor", LIGHT_FLICKER_SENSOR, true, REPORT_MODE_ON_CHANGE, 2, 2}
#define SENSOR_INFO_PROXIMITY {"proximity_sensor", PROXIMITY_SENSOR, true, REPORT_MODE_ON_CHANGE, 3, 1}
#define SENSOR_INFO_PROXIMITY_ALERT {"proximity_alert_sensor", PROXIMITY_ALERT_SENSOR, true, REPORT_MODE_ON_CHANGE, 3, 1}
#define SENSOR_INFO_PROXIMITY_RAW {"proximity_raw", PROXIMITY_RAW, false, REPORT_MODE_ON_CHANGE, 1, 0}
#define SENSOR_INFO_ROTATION_VECTOR {"rotation_vector_sensor", ROTATION_VECTOR, true, REPORT_MODE_CONTINUOUS, 17, 17}
#define SENSOR_INFO_GAME_ROTATION_VECTOR {"game_rotation_vector", GAME_ROTATION_VECTOR, true, REPORT_MODE_CONTINUOUS, 17, 17}
#define SENSOR_INFO_SIGNIFICANT_MOTION {"sig_motion_sensor", SIG_MOTION_SENSOR, true, REPORT_MODE_SPECIAL, 1, 1}
#define SENSOR_INFO_STEP_DETECTOR {"step_det_sensor", STEP_DETECTOR, true, REPORT_MODE_ON_CHANGE, 1, 1}
#define SENSOR_INFO_STEP_COUNTER {"step_cnt_sensor", STEP_COUNTER, true, REPORT_MODE_ON_CHANGE, 4, 8}
#define SENSOR_INFO_TILT_DETECTOR {"tilt_detector", TILT_DETECTOR, true, REPORT_MODE_ON_CHANGE, 1, 1}
#define SENSOR_INFO_PICK_UP_GESTURE {"pickup_gesture", PICKUP_GESTURE, true, REPORT_MODE_CONTINUOUS, 1, 1}
#define SENSOR_INFO_SCONTEXT {"scontext_iio", META_SENSOR+1, true, REPORT_MODE_CONTINUOUS, 0, 64}
#define SENSOR_INFO_THERMISTOR {"thermistor_sensor", THERMISTOR_SENSOR, true, REPORT_MODE_SPECIAL, 3, 3}
#define SENSOR_INFO_PROXIMITY_POCKET {"proximity_pocket", PROXIMITY_POCKET, true, REPORT_MODE_CONTINUOUS, 3, 1}
#define SENSOR_INFO_ACCEL_UNCALIBRATED {"uncal_accel_sensor", ACCEL_UNCALIB_SENSOR, true, REPORT_MODE_CONTINUOUS, 12, 12}
#define SENSOR_INFO_META {"meta_event", META_SENSOR, true, REPORT_MODE_CONTINUOUS, 8, 8}
#define SENSOR_INFO_WAKE_UP_MOTION {"wake_up_motion", WAKE_UP_MOTION, true, REPORT_MODE_CONTINUOUS, 1, 1}
#define SENSOR_INFO_MOVE_DETECTOR {"move_detector", MOVE_DETECTOR, true, REPORT_MODE_ON_CHANGE, 1, 1}
#define SENSOR_INFO_CALL_GESTURE {"call_gesture", CALL_GESTURE, true, REPORT_MODE_ON_CHANGE, 1, 1}
#define SENSOR_INFO_LED_COVER_EVENT {"led_cover_event", LED_COVER_EVENT_SENSOR, true, REPORT_MODE_ON_CHANGE, 1, 1}
#define SENSOR_INFO_AUTO_ROTATION {"autorotation", AUTO_ROTATION_SENSOR, true, REPORT_MODE_ON_CHANGE, 1, 1}
#define SENSOR_INFO_SAR_BACKOFF_MOTION {"sarbackoffmotion", SAR_BACKOFF_MOTION, true, REPORT_MODE_SPECIAL, 1, 1}
#define SENSOR_INFO_POCKET_MODE_LITE {"pocket_mode_lite", POCKET_MODE_LITE, true, REPORT_MODE_ON_CHANGE, 5, 5}
#endif
